Phlox divaricata x pilosa

'Chattahoochee' Woodland Phlox is a delightful cross between Woodland and Prairie Phlox. From late spring to early summer, it graces our gardens with its fragrant, star-shaped lavender flowers with charming maroon centers, drawing in butterflies, hummingbirds, and other lovely pollinators.

This wonderful plant spreads gently, creating a beautiful mid-height ground cover that enriches any garden design. Moreover, this award-winning native woodland wildflower flourishes in moist, rich soils, making it a fantastic choice for any garden enthusiast.


Height: 6”-12”
Spread: 6”-12”
Bloom: April-May
Light: Part Shade, Full Shade
Water: Medium
Zone: 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8
Origin: North America
Deer Resistant: Yes

5 Gallon and Up: Any plant purchased to ship over 5 Gallons will be shipped bare root. This means we will remove the plant from its original pot, remove the soil surrounding the roots, and wrap the roots with a biodegradable plastic bag. This reduces weight and the likelihood of damage during shipping. 

Once your plants arrive, it is essential to plant them as soon as possible. This will help them rebound and thrive. If you cannot plant immediately, water regularly and keep the roots off heat-conducting surfaces.

Newly transplanted plants often require more water until their roots are well established. Plan to water them 1-3 times weekly for the first few months.
